Transaction 64f570f505120225ed564815753d7eb4e80eb579a955741599ef29cf677f3013
1 Input
1 Output
-
64f570f505120225ed564815753d7eb4e80eb579a955741599ef29cf677f3013:0
- value
- 106092222
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d00b4c427b10ad4643533f9490398e42cc1cd94e1a5492f9c36d4d66728c0eaf
- address
- bc1p6q95csnmzzk5vs6n872fqwvwgtxpek2wrf2f97wrd4xkvu5vp6hs6uu3xy